CentOS 7 安裝 Pydio


Pydio (前身是 AjaXplorer) 是一開源的檔案分享及同步工具, 它可以讓使用者透過 Web, 行動裝置及桌面應用程式存取檔案。以下會介紹在 CentOS 7 安裝 Pydio 的步驟:

首先要在系統建立 LAMP 環境, 可參考文章:

安裝 Pydio 可以先安裝 Pydio 的 YUM Repository, 然後就可以用 YUM 安裝:

# rpm -Uvh http://dl.ajaxplorer.info/repos/pydio-release-1-1.noarch.rpm

用 YUM 安裝 Pydio:

# yum update
# yum install pydio

然後編輯 /etc/httpd/conf.d/pydio.conf, 它是 Pydio 的設定檔:

另外需要設定 SELinux 以及重新啟動 Apache:

# chcon -R -t httpd_sys_content_t /usr/share/pydio/
# systemctl restart httpd

安裝好 Pydio 後, 現在開啟 Pydio 使用的 MySQL 資料庫, 以下假設新的的資料庫是 pydio, 用戶名稱是 pydiouser, 密碼是 pydiopasswd:

# mysql -u root -p

mysql> create database pydiodb;
mysql> create user pydiouser@localhost identified by ‘pydiopasswd’;
mysql> grant all on pydiodb.* to pydiouser@localhost;
mysql> FLUSH PRIVILEGES;
mysql> exit;

現在可以用 Pydio 的網頁介面設定, 假設伺服器的 ip 是 192.168.0.10, 用以下網址進入:

http://192.168.0.10/pydio

按 “Start wizard”, 然後設定 Pydio 的使用者名稱及密碼.

在下一步輸入在上面建立的 MySQL 賬戶資料, 然後跟著指示做就可以完安裝了。

Leave a Reply